Complementary User Entity Controls
Plan Sponsors should have controls in place to authorize and submit qualified employee
enrollments to MassMutual timely and accurately.
Plan Sponsors should have controls in place to provide timely and accurate notification of relevant
changes to MassMutual.
For plans that have elected the automatic enrollment feature using a data file transmitted through
the TRC, Plan Sponsors should have controls in place to ensure that all participants are setup
within payroll.
Plan Sponsors should have controls in place to review plans to ensure that plan changes including
plan changes in response to legislative requirements submitted to MassMutual are applied
accurately and processed timely.
Plan Sponsors should have controls in place to ensure only authorized customer representatives
have access and are authorized to instruct MassMutual transactions and plan changes on behalf of
the Plan Sponsor through the TRC and notify MassMutual of changes in a timely manner.
